The Mailloom batch digest scheduler now signs all scheduled-job payloads with a rotated key, effective this release. Plugin authors who verify digest webhooks must update their verification logic: payloads signed with the previous key will validate only during the 14-day grace window, after which they are rejected outright. Scheduling semantics are unchanged — digests still batch hourly and honor per-tenant quiet windows. Please update your plugin's trust store before the grace window closes. The new public signing key is provided below.

release key, bawig-kahip: bky4_bSxn

Subject: Handover — nightly Quillsearch reindex

Handing off on-call for the Quillsearch reindex. Last night's run finished clean at 03:40; the prior night stalled on shard 7 and needed a manual kick. Watch the lag dashboard after 02:00. Runbook is current. If the job stalls twice in a row, loop in the indexing team.

escalation mailbox, yajeg-bageg: quenax.olidor@lumiccorp.internal

### v3.8.1 — key rotation

Heads up, plugin folks: we rotated the signing key for ScrubPix, our EXIF-scrubbing service. Old key stops validating next Friday, no exceptions this time. The scrub pipeline itself is unchanged — GPS, serials, and thumbnails still get stripped exactly as before — so no code changes needed on your end, just swap the trust anchor. The new public signing key is below.

deploy key for kajof-fajop: bky6_gDHw9Q

## Deployment

BranchSweep runs as a single container on the Pellwick cluster — nothing fancy. Push to main, CI builds the image, and the scheduler picks it up within ten minutes. If the bot starts flagging branches it shouldn't, check the age thresholds first. The deployed configuration looks like this.

deployment values, yahag-tawef:
ZORWYN_HOST=zorwyn.tolvaqlabs.internal
ZORWYN_PORT=9300